Actions on an Object in a List
In an object list:
• when you click an object, its proprieties display over the list itself
• other actions on an object are available:
• (after selecting the object) in the menu bar of the list
• when you hover the cursor over the Local Name column of the object
• when you right-click the object row, in the object conextual menu
Actions on an object using the menu bar of a list
When you select an object in a list of objects, the menu bar of the list enables you to perform general actions on the object.

Actions on an object from the Local Name of a list
In a list of objects, when you hover the cursor over the Local Name of an object, a list of buttons pops up:
• In the first part of the list, you can perform current actions on the object.
• The second part of the list gives you direct access to features related to this object.

Object pop-up menu
To access all the commands specific to an object in a list:

Right-click the object row and in its pop-up menu, select the action.
